We work across South-East Essex to support people experiencing mental health difficulties, families and other community members. Our projects support over 1,500 people a year in Southend, Rochford and Castle Point.

WebRecovery colleges are an education‑based approach to supporting mental health recovery through a framework of shared learning and co‑production.
